qtmobility/plugins/multimedia/qt7/qt7playersession.h
changeset 4 90517678cc4f
parent 1 2b40d63a9c3d
child 5 453da2cfceef
equal deleted inserted replaced
1:2b40d63a9c3d 4:90517678cc4f
    91     bool isVideoAvailable() const;
    91     bool isVideoAvailable() const;
    92 
    92 
    93     bool isSeekable() const;
    93     bool isSeekable() const;
    94 
    94 
    95     qreal playbackRate() const;
    95     qreal playbackRate() const;
       
    96 
       
    97 public slots:
    96     void setPlaybackRate(qreal rate);
    98     void setPlaybackRate(qreal rate);
    97 
    99 
    98     void setPosition(qint64 pos);
   100     void setPosition(qint64 pos);
    99 
   101 
   100     void play();
   102     void play();
   103 
   105 
   104     void setVolume(int volume);
   106     void setVolume(int volume);
   105     void setMuted(bool muted);
   107     void setMuted(bool muted);
   106 
   108 
   107     void processEOS();
   109     void processEOS();
       
   110     void processStateChange();
       
   111     void processVolumeChange();
   108 
   112 
   109 signals:
   113 signals:
   110     void positionChanged(qint64 position);
   114     void positionChanged(qint64 position);
   111     void durationChanged(qint64 duration);
   115     void durationChanged(qint64 duration);
   112     void stateChanged(QMediaPlayer::State newState);
   116     void stateChanged(QMediaPlayer::State newState);